Sans soufre bottling, pale red in colour with cherry, strawberry and grapefruit flavours accented by bright peppery and gravel notes. Very light on its feet with really bright acids giving the fruit an incredible sense of clarity and freshness, really complex and layered without any sensation of weight. Lovely wine and really refreshing to drink at the end of the night.

(Tissot (Bénédicte et Stéphane / André et Mireille) Poulsard Arbois Vieilles Vignes) Light medium brick red color with clear meniscus; hibiscus, oxidative, floral, earthy nose; tart red fruit, hibiscus, tart blood orange, mineral palate with mouthwatering acidity and tannin; medium finish 90+ pts.
